Runs every Tuesday from 9am to 2pm at Sant Jordi de Cercs, outdoors. Fruit, vegetables, meat, fish, cheese, bread and clothing stalls.

Sant Jordi Market, or Mercat de Sant Jordi de Cercs, sets up every Tuesday from 9am to 2pm at Sant Jordi de Cercs, in Barcelona province. It is one of the street markets in Cercs, and you can see all markets in Cercs alongside it.

What you'll find at Sant Jordi Market

Food takes up most of the stalls: fruit and vegetables, meat and poultry, fish and seafood, cheese and dairy, and bread and bakery. Clothing and textiles are the one non-food line. Bring cash, since card acceptance varies from one stall to the next.

Where to stay in Cercs

Cercs is small and beds are scarce in the village itself, so most people stay nearby. The Berguedà region has rural guesthouses and small hotels within easy driving distance, and Berga town centre, a short drive away, offers more choice for a longer stay.

What day is Sant Jordi Market?

Sant Jordi Market runs every Tuesday, from 9am to 2pm, weekly through the year rather than seasonally. Stalls go up in the morning and are packed away by two in the afternoon, so arrive mid-morning if you want the fish, bread and fruit stalls at their fullest.

Where is Sant Jordi Market in Cercs?

Sant Jordi Market runs at Sant Jordi de Cercs, the village that gives the market its name, in the municipality of Cercs, Barcelona province. It is an open-air market with no permanent hall, so on a Tuesday morning look for the stalls in the open rather than for a building.

Does Sant Jordi Market take cards?

Sant Jordi Market has no card payment recorded at its stalls, so carry cash. Acceptance varies from one trader to the next at a market this size, and with fruit, meat, fish, cheese, bread and clothing all sold by separate stallholders, you will be paying several of them.
